Neevea Batters, 1900

Holotype species: Neevea repens Batters

Original publication and holotype designation: Batters, E.A.L. (1900). New or critical British marine algae. Journal of Botany, British and Foreign 38: 369-379, pl. 414.

Description: Microscopic thallus with cells arranged in uniseriate or multiseriate rows within a thick mucilaginous sheath. These pseudofilaments are procumbent and irregularly branched. Each cell contains several parietal, disk-shaped or irregular chloroplasts. Pyrenoids absent. Pit plugs absent and growth is intercalary or diffuse. Older parts of the thallus can become parenchymatous, up to several cells in thickness. Asexual reproduction via archeospores formed when the entire content of a vegetative cell is transformed into an archeosporangium. A single archeospore per archeosporangium is released. Sexual reproduction unknown. Thalli growing endozoically in bryozoa, worm tubes, or ascidians. Reported from northern Europe, southern British Columbia, and California.
